Type
ORACLE
Validation date
2025-05-28 20:41: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.5786e-4,
    "usd": 1.7829e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E83F3327F8A79DFF590123BB7D43F23F466139606F2181F2D3338C64465FFEE8

Previous signature

0E4666CEEE1ED78FE38FEC5098A33DFEBFCCA70D5F62A177413DBD3E92967B78058E34657F2424B8F91A098E4AEB86D3615996447463AEC15E88C85B4AA15906

Origin signature

3045022100937B377BAFF7468F790DA5629541BC3FFEB7D81019766BB496DC16909DE6C71C0220582386F0E43B6F7133758BAABA8EACF2A50E7D65EF242409C80A77C934F9100E

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00278066701C6CAF43A2373A7597D72B087819842823DCC2D4E1D81C4ABB5BB97B

Coordinator signature

B114D579611F2A55F8C814B408D447F12E7B070C4B1E30B89046CB0A4222E9804E8674213635E863D27A87C98767726209AD332D9E3CF733E11C3E83B654800E

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

B7E8D63D8B9DF69F7E3883D7303824479B1BAFD34DA3E61D9A4B9E51475FBB9E51D8A2671A9CB2F82AB8E1AE5C0022375EA654CD794E9EE3B2E2C1B856009407

Validator #2 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#2 signature

5B22C871582004B8378AA8A0BDB2D31D9BFFB99EBA72C1C7383E5D5A4488313FFBEEE408BF7ABC8CAEC774F8AE54DBBAB9AF7EF739D7A2DF7F5BF266B6F65B05